after a horrid 7 hour delay and not a great flight we ended up getting to our villa about midnight,anyhooooooooow after a quick visit to winn dixie for supplies we got to Disney's hollywood studios about 9.30 am where a quick trip up sunset blvd took us on to my fav ride and our first of the day TOWER OF TERROR,it was awsome as allways and although a bit worried at first kristine enjoyed it a lot,after that we went over to catch the first showing of indiana jones stunt show,we bypassed star tours as it was a 30 min wait and kristine didnt fancy it once she knew it was a simulator,we then hopped over to catch lights motors action first time we had seen this and we enjoyed it a lot,then off to muppetvision for some 3d fun,it was then we realised quite a few hours had gone already and it was lunch time so we hit toy story pizza planet, we had tried to book a fantasmic dinning package but it was fully booked,in fact every disney ressie was full throughout our vacation,after lunch we took a walk through the park to take in the ambience and atmospherewe then caught the little mermaid show and then hopped over to watch the beauty and the beast stage show which was great as always but still disapointed that theres no 4 for a dollar pre-show any more :( also thought they had cut the little mermaid show down some too.late afternoon saw us do backstage tour where kristine and i where chosen to take part in the warship,submarine thing beforehand, it was really good and we kicked ourselves for not giving the camcorder to another guest to tape it for us,kris then browsed a few shops as i went on star tours it was a walk on which is a first for me was a bit disapointed to see the bike speeder that you can get your pic taken was no longer there,forgot to mention the afternoon parade which was ok but i prefer the older ones that have been there over last 12 yrs or so,then over to rock n roller coaster which kris didnt do so as a single rider i had a 5 min wait,time seemed to disappear fast we had eaten at rosie's all american cafe and found we had time to ride tower of terror once more before getting in the queue for fantasmic which as always was great it was the 2nd showing that night and i reckon only 3 quarters full but still great,we never got to do one mans dream(which annoyed me) american idol (wasnt to bothered by that)sounds dangerous (closed)or the new toy story mania for some strange reason we kept passing it,all in all a great day dont know how time passed us by so fast,didnt really see many characters around the park and thought DHS not as good as i remembered it to be but i will always go just for tower of terror, rnroll coaster and fantasmic,kristine enjoyed her first day at a Disney park and so it was home to the villa for a quick beer and a look at the pics we had taken,and then off to bed to get some sleep before the next big day my prposal at magic kingdom.
